Latin, to be a language employed by the educated, and also the language in the Anglo-Saxons equally had a profound influence on the spelling and pronunciation of Norman names in Britain. On the other hand, the Norman language affected the event of English. Since the English language designed from its Germanic roots into Middle English (which was motivated by Norman French) we find a interval all through which spelling wasn't standardised but approximately adopted phonetic pronunciation. All through this time names were being spelled several different means dependent upon area dialects. Consequently the surname, as well as the Anglo-Saxon names, have been recorded in a variety of strategies.[10]

Jacques is with the Latin title Jacobus. It is just a masculine title Which means "supplanter" or "a person who follows". It's also linked to the Hebrew title Yaakov, which implies "he who supplants".[two]
